I-765, APPLICATION FOR EMPLOYMENT AUTHORIZATION DOCUMENT (EAD)
The Form I-765 is a request for an Employment Authorization Document or commonly referred to as an “EAD” which is known as a work permit. If you will be in the U.S. temporarily and will need a job, you will have to file an EAD. The EAD is a proof of employment authorization, and immigrants who want to work must file the Form I-765. Once approved for EAD, the applicant will obtain their identification card which they will use towards their employment. If you have filed this form previously but have lost your EAD or are need of renewing, you should file from I-765. One of the common reasons why a Form I-765 is rejected is due to misidentifying eligibility. This form is quite complicated and identifying which category of eligibility you are filing under is difficult. WHAT ARE THE CONSEQUENCES OF WORKING WITHOUT AUTHORIZATION?
Working the U.S. without a work permit can put your entire green card application at risk. USCIS will closely scrutinize any green card application from an applicant who has previously worked without authorization. The penalties for working without authorization include being barred from entering the U.S. for three to ten years depending on how long you were working without a permit.
